uGet 1.9.1 (devel) 1. Add new option "User Agent" in download dialog. 2. Fix: Source package doesn't include some project files for Windows. uGet 1.9.0 (devel) 1. Drop GTK+2, I suggest use uGet with GTK 3.4+. (avoid some GTK3 bugs) 2. Avoid crash when user delete tasks and uGet run with GTK3. (GTK3 bug?) 3. Add Commandline Settings for some FlashGot users. 4. Add setting option 'Apply recently download settings'. Some users want to use uGet with FlashGot quietly. In the old nGet you must add uGet as new download manager and set commandline arguments in FlashGot. Now the new Commandline Settings is a easy way to do this. uGet apply download settings from category by default but some users want to use recently download settings when creating new download. The new option 'Apply recently download settings' is for this case. Note: The recently download settings will be discard when you quit uGet. How to disable uGet AppIndicator support: Search <AppIndicator value='1'/> in $HOME/.config/uGet/Setting.xml and set value='0' to disable AppIndicator. This is function is for Ubuntu GNOME users who want to use original tray icon logic.
